Tifel Tafel and Tofel

inspired by an old Austrian Folktale


Produced by 


in association with 


Performed by award-winning storyteller Danyah Miller

Directed by Sofie Miller


A heart-warming solstice story for all the family, young and old alike.

As the nights draw in and we look forward to celebrating a joyful festive season, there are some who won't receive gifts, some who will be alone without family and friends and those who will go hungry. But, did you know that, once a year around the time of the Winter solstice, King Laurin, King of all the Goblins in the High Tyrol, will sneak down into the village and secretly visit one family. It is said that he will play his tricks and share his bounty with them.

You're invited to snuggle up around our proverbial fire, with family and friends, to celebrate the festive season with this playful, trickster story about trust, sharing and more than a little splash of mischief!

Running Time: 50 minutes
